DIY vs Removalist
When it comes to planning your move, one of the key decisions you’ll face is whether to opt for a DIY approach or hire professional removalists. Many people consider DIY moving as a viable option since it often proves to be significantly cheaper than hiring a removalist service. By taking on the task yourself, you can save on labour costs and possibly even transport expenses if you own or can borrow a vehicle.
In a DIY move, you have complete control over how the packing, loading, and transport is managed. This flexibility allows you to set your own schedule, which can reduce stress and ensure that everything is done according to your preferences. Packing your belongings at your own pace can also help ensure that they are handled with care, as you know what items require special attention.
Using a DIY approach also provides an opportunity to declutter; as you pack, you can sort through items to determine what you really need to keep and what can be sold, donated, or discarded. This process not only reduces the volume of items you need to move but can also save money on transport costs for unnecessary goods.
On the other hand, while hiring a removalist can offer convenience, it comes at a premium. The cost of professional services, while they may handle the heavy lifting and transportation, can quickly add up. For those on a tighter budget or looking to maintain greater financial control over their move, DIY is often the most practical solution.

Road Safety Tips
Ensure your vehicle is in good condition before starting the journey, with checks on tyre pressure, oil levels, and brakes. Always stay hydrated and take regular breaks to avoid fatigue. Be cautious of wildlife, especially in rural areas where animals may cross roads. Adhere to speed limits and be aware of road signs and conditions, as some rural areas may have variable weather impacts. Always keep your mobile phone charged and inform someone of your travel plans.

Things to Keep in Mind When Moving from Mackay to Geelong
When making the transition from Mackay to Geelong, it’s essential to consider the significant climate differences. Mackay boasts a tropical climate with warm temperatures year-round and a distinct wet season, while Geelong experiences a temperate oceanic climate, characterised by cooler winters and mild summers. This change may affect your lifestyle and the types of clothing you’ll need, so be prepared to adjust your wardrobe accordingly. Additionally, Geelong is approximately 18 degrees Celsius cooler on average than Mackay during winter, so investing in some warmer clothing options will be wise.
Another key aspect to think about is the cost of living. Geelong tends to have a higher cost of housing compared to Mackay, so researching the local rental or housing market beforehand is crucial. Familiarising yourself with the suburbs of Geelong can also help you find an area that suits your lifestyle, whether you prefer the vibrant atmosphere of the city centre or the tranquillity of the surrounding suburbs. Don’t forget to explore local amenities, including schools, healthcare facilities, and recreational activities, as these can greatly impact your settling experience.
